Journal of Russian Laser Research | 1980

High-power 20-channel neodymium glass laser and combined laser and beam heating of a plasma

Ya. V. Afanas'ev; N.G. Basov; V. A. Gribkov; A. I. Isakov; N. V. Kalachev; Oleg N. Krokhin; L. V. Krupnova; V. Ya. Nikulin; V. V. Pustovalov; A. B. Romanov; M. A. Savchenko; O. G. Semenov; V. P. Silin; G. V. Sklizkov

A high-power 20-channel neodymium-glass laser is described (energy i kJ, pulse duration 2 nsec). It is part of the “Flora” facility intended for combined simultaneous heating of a plasma by powerful laser radiation (PLR) and by a relativistic electron beam (REB) produced in a facility of the “plasma focus” type. The paper deals theoretically with the processes of combined interaction of PLR and REB with a current plasma and a solid target.
